Planets in Zodiac Signs: Fundamental Characteristics
The placement of planets in different zodiac signs in the natal chart provides information about the fundamental ways we express their energies. Understanding these influences is key to self-knowledge.
| Planet | Core Themes | Impact on Personal Growth |
|---|---|---|
| Sun | Essence, identity, life force, ego | Understanding one's deepest essence and how to express it authentically. Developing confidence and self-esteem. |
| Moon | Emotions, instincts, subconscious, needs, home comfort | Awareness and management of the emotional world. Fulfilling basic needs for emotional security. Developing intuition. |
| Mercury | Communication, thinking, learning, curiosity | Improving communication skills. Developing critical thinking and learning ability. Clarity of thought. |
| Venus | Love, harmony, values, aesthetics, pleasures | Understanding one's own values in relationships and life. Developing the capacity for love, harmony, and enjoyment. |
| Mars | Energy, action, ambition, aggression, passion | Directing energy towards constructive goals. Managing anger and aggression. Developing courage and decisiveness. |
| Jupiter | Expansion, luck, optimism, faith, wisdom | Expanding horizons. Developing faith in oneself and the future. Seeking wisdom and meaning. |
| Saturn | Structure, discipline, responsibility, limitations, learning through experience | Building discipline and responsibility. Overcoming fears and limitations. Learning through difficulties and achieving long-term goals. |
Houses in the Natal Chart: Areas of Life
Each of the 12 houses in the natal chart represents a specific area of life. The placement of planets in houses and the signs ruling these houses provide valuable information about potential challenges and opportunities for development.
| House | Area of Life | Focus for Personal Growth |
|---|---|---|
| 1st House (Ascendant) | Personality, appearance, first impression, beginnings | Developing authenticity, self-acceptance, confidence in self-expression. |
| 2nd House | Values, finances, resources, self-esteem | Building healthy self-esteem, recognizing personal values, responsible resource management. |
| 3rd House | Communication, siblings, short travel, learning | Improving communication, developing curiosity, lifelong learning. |
| 4th House (IC) | Home, family, roots, emotional security | Building healthy family relationships, creating a sense of belonging and emotional security. |
| 5th House | Creativity, romance, children, pleasures, self-expression | Developing creative potential, finding joy in life, daring to express oneself freely. |
| 6th House | Work, health, daily routines, service | Building healthy habits, finding meaning in daily work, taking care of health. |
| 7th House (Descendant) | Partnerships, marriage, open enemies | Developing skills for compromise, empathy, and constructive communication in partnerships. |
| 8th House | Transformation, sex, shared resources, deep secrets | Overcoming fears, accepting change, understanding the cycle of life and death, working with deep psychological themes. |
| 9th House | Philosophy, higher education, travel, faith | Expanding worldview, seeking meaning, developing personal philosophy and faith. |
| 10th House (MC) | Career, reputation, public status, ambitions | Building a career, understanding one's public role, achieving professional goals. |
| 11th House | Groups, friendships, hopes, dreams, humanitarianism | Building supportive social connections, teamwork, realizing dreams and ideals. |
| 12th House | Subconscious, solitude, spiritual practices, karmic debts | Working with the subconscious, developing spiritual practices, overcoming karmic lessons, finding inner peace. |
Astrological Aspects: Dynamics and Integration
The aspects between planets show how different aspects of personality interact. They can be harmonious (sextile, trine) or challenging (square, opposition). Understanding these aspects helps in integrating different parts of oneself.
| Aspect | Degrees | Nature | Key to Personal Growth |
|---|---|---|---|
| Conjunction | 0° | Fusion, amplification | Integrating the energies of the planets. Developing awareness of their mutual influence. |
| Sextile | 60° | Harmonious, opportunities | Utilizing opportunities for cooperation and development. Easy integration of qualities. |
| Square | 90° | Challenging, tension, conflict | Resolving inner conflicts, learning through overcoming difficulties, developing strength and decisiveness. |
| Trine | 120° | Harmonious, ease, flow | Natural expression of talents. Need for awareness so as not to take everything for granted. |
| Opposition | 180° | Balance, awareness through contrast, projection | Finding balance between opposites. Understanding oneself through relationships with others. Integrating projections. |

How does divination help with self-discovery?
Divination serves as a mirror, reflecting unconscious patterns and possibilities. It stimulates introspection and helps you see situations from a new perspective.
What questions should I ask?
Avoid yes/no questions. Ask "What can I learn from...", "How can I approach...", "What is preventing me from...". Open-ended questions yield richer answers.
Do I need to believe in divination?
Blind faith is not required. Approach with curiosity and openness. Divination works as a tool for reflection, whether you believe in its mystical aspect.
How often should I consult?
For personal development, a monthly or seasonal consultation is sufficient. Consulting too often can create dependency and hinder your own decision-making.
